Toketee Falls is a waterfall in Douglas County, Oregon, United States, on the North Umpqua River at its confluence with the Clearwater River. [1] [2] It is located approximately 58 miles (93 km) east of Roseburg near Oregon Route 138. [3] Toketee (pronounced TOKE-uh-tee), is a Chinook Jargon word meaning "pretty" or "graceful". [2]

A section of project pipeline near Toketee Falls. The North Umpqua Hydroelectric Project is a series of hydroelectric power generation facilities along the North Umpqua River in Douglas County, Oregon, United States. The project is owned and operated by PacifiCorp.
Clearwater is an unincorporated community in Douglas County, Oregon, United States. [1] It is located north of Oregon Route 138 about 43 miles east of Glide, at the confluence of the North Umpqua and Clearwater rivers. [2] It is within the Umpqua National Forest near Toketee Falls and Toketee Lake. [2]

The Clearwater River is a river in Douglas County of the U.S. state of Oregon. [1] It is a roughly 15-mile (24 km) long tributary of the North Umpqua River, located about 50 miles (80 km) east of Roseburg in the Cascade Range.
